Transaction 66973224e41faaa2ee138b64cc089a51a8823cc5306d0e1b9398e9928cd7604b

1 Input
2 Outputs
  • 66973224e41faaa2ee138b64cc089a51a8823cc5306d0e1b9398e9928cd7604b:0
  • value  192477
    address  3AGYaYQTJzSekbqx6UUV7QKxVfbu3KQnP2
  • 66973224e41faaa2ee138b64cc089a51a8823cc5306d0e1b9398e9928cd7604b:1
  • value  7803345
    address  16Cpk9Dw1t58NYLZh8EQp9u9HkQgD7Kk3y